Sensitivity and specificity are crucial in medical diagnostics, where sensitivity refers to a test's ability to correctly identify those with the disease (true positive rate), and specificity refers to its ability to correctly identify those without the disease (true negative rate).

## **Clinical Pearl / High-Yield Fact**
A key point to remember is that when evaluating diagnostic tests, both sensitivity and specificity are critical. A highly sensitive test is good for ruling out a disease (a negative result effectively excludes the condition), while a highly specific test is good for confirming a disease (a positive result effectively confirms the condition). The ideal test has both high sensitivity and specificity.
